There are some good places to run but it’s very different to NZ as you have to go to a spot to run.  You can’t just run around the neighbourhood.  The reason for this is that there are little businesses on the footpath!  So even if you get up early to avoid the crowds of pedestrians you still can’t really run around as the footpath is blocked most of the time.
